<p><strong>About the opportunity</strong></p>
<p><strong>At Aiviq, we create clarity for the world’s investment managers</strong>. Our cloud-based data and analytics platform<br>turns disparate client investment information into enterprise-wide datasets driving both greater clarity and the<br>ability to derive deeper insights for hundreds of industry use cases across our Investment Manager customers.</p>
<p>We’re investing in our Customer Services capability, both by building out the team and implementing the tools<br>to be able to deliver industry leading service to our customers in a scalable and sustainable way. We are looking<br>for Customer Services Analysts to build out our Customer Services capability in India. Successful candidates<br>should be highly customer focused with strong communication and a problem-solving mindset. Successful<br>candidates should also be able to support the diagnosis and resolution of complex client data and system<br>challenges as well as being open to building a broader technical skill set.</p>
<p><strong>What you will be doing</strong></p>
<p>Our Customer Services team provides day-to-day support and proactive data quality monitoring to ensure<br>customer satisfaction. Your key responsibilities will be to:</p>
<ul>
<li>Trouble-shoot system failures and investigate customer queries</li>
<li>Conduct regular checks on customer systems and promptly address any failures</li>
<li>Build and maintain data connectors for existing and/or new data sources</li>
<li>Support release testing on new features and enhancements prior to customer releases</li>
<li>We can offer some flexibility in working location, but we will expect the analyst to work at least three days a<br>week in our Hyderabad office</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>What you will need</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>A technical background coupled with experience of working in customer facing roles</li>
<li>Proficiency in SQL and experience of supporting or developing computer systems.</li>
<li>Familiarity with different file formats (e.g. Excel, csv)</li>
<li>Strong organizational skills and attention to detail</li>
<li>Good written and verbal English communication skills</li>
<li>Willingness to work independently with minimal supervision, taking initiatives to address challenges</li>
<li>Experience with the Microsoft Office suite (particularly Excel) and data analysis skills</li>
<li>Experience in Asset Management industry is preferred but not mandatory</li>
</ul>

<p><strong>About Aiviq</strong></p>
<p>Aiviq is growing UK-based FinTech, specialising in developing SaaS products for the world’s investment<br>Managers. We are backed by Alpha Financial Markets Consulting Plc, a global Asset & Wealth Management<br>Consultancy.</p>
